While airline generally strive to have new, state-of-the-art, fleets, there are some exceptions to this rule.

Vintage aircraft have also their appeal and this is something Lufthansa has understood perfectly well. 

At at time when most European flag carriers are approaching rather venerable ages (KLM will become a centenary in a couple year's time!), Lufthansa stand out in its commitment to preserving its historical heritage.

And this does not just mean keeping aircraft in a museum, but investing to keep some oldies in flying condition.

In this article for CNN I explain how the German airline is adding a Super Constellation (practically re-built in the inside) to its Junkers Ju-52 (not Lufthansa's but this is how it feels like to fly on a Ju-52) and it has also participated in the recovery of a historical Boeing 737-200, this one for static display only.
